WebMar 23, 2024 · Florida Health Care Plan, Inc. was incorporated as a not-for-profit entity on June 2, 1971, commenced operations on July 1, 1974, and was federally qualified on August 21, 1976. On January 26th, 1994, Florida Health Care Plans became a wholly owned not-for-profit subsidiary of Halifax Community Health System. WebMar 9, 2024 · Additionally, in order to deduct medical expenses, including health insurance, from your taxes, your total medical expenses must exceed 7.5% of your AGI — and you can only deduct the amount above that 7.5%. For example, if your AGI is $100,000 and your medical expenses total $9,500, you'd be able to deduct $2,000 of medical expenses.
